Best known as Topanga Lawrence on the beloved '90s sitcom Boy Meets World, Danielle Fishel spent seven years joining millions of viewers in their living rooms every Friday night. Offscreen, her life has been just as memorable?if far messier. From disastrous auditions and dating misfires to cringe-worthy red-carpet moments, Danielle's journey proves that even successful actresses face their share of embarrassing setbacks.
Written with charm, candor, and a generous sense of humor, this memoir embraces imperfection in all its forms. Danielle shares stories of social missteps, romantic mishaps, and public faux pas with a refreshing honesty that makes her instantly relatable. Whether she's recounting a mortifying fall, an ill-timed bodily betrayal, or an unforgettable brush with celebrity, she approaches every moment with humor and heart.
Lighthearted, uplifting, and laugh-out-loud funny, this essay-style memoir celebrates resilience, self-acceptance, and the joy of not taking yourself too seriously?even when you've just face-planted in front of Ben Affleck.

The file format ePub works well for novels and non-fiction books – i.e., „flowing” text without complex layout. On an e-reader or smartphone, line and page breaks automatically adjust to fit the small displays.
This eBook uses Adobe-DRM, a „hard” copy protection. If the necessary requirements are not met, unfortunately you will not be able to open the eBook. You will therefore need to prepare your reading hardware before downloading.
